Beagles have approximately 220 million scent receptors, compared to a human's mere 5 million!
Dalmatians are born completely white, with their distinctive spots developing during their first few weeks of life.
Developed in England during the 1500s for hunting rabbits and hares in packs. Their keen sense of smell and tracking abilities made them preferred hunting companions.
Developed in Croatia's Dalmatia region during the 18th century as carriage dogs, running alongside horse-drawn carriages and serving as guard dogs at night for traveling nobles.
